Mason Marchment — NHL Profile & Early Life

Mason Marchment: Jersey| Contract| Wife| Height| Salary| Kraken

Mason Marchment is a Canadian professional ice hockey forward, widely known for his imposing presence on ice and relentless style of play. Born on June 18, 1995, in Uxbridge, Ontario, Canada, Marchment has defied early expectations to carve out a significant NHL career. He was undrafted, yet through perseverance in junior and minor professional leagues he earned his NHL opportunity — a story that inspires many up-and-coming hockey players. 

Marchment grew up in a hockey family. His father, Bryan Marchment, was a long-time NHL defenseman who played 17 seasons and became renowned for his toughness and commitment. Mason’s sister, Logan, also grew up around the game, and the family legacy in ice hockey runs deep. 

After his initial major junior years, Mason reached the NHL debut with the Toronto Maple Leafs and later became an impactful scorer for the Florida Panthers and Dallas Stars before moving on to other teams.

Contract Details & Salary Breakdown

Mason Marchment signed his current four-year, $18 million NHL contract with the Dallas Stars on July 13, 2022. That contract carried an average annual value (AAV) or cap hit of $4.5 million

Contract highlights:

  • Term: 4 years

  • Total Value: $18,000,000

  • Cap Hit (AAV): $4.5M per season 

  • Status: Contract set to expire after the 2025-26 season, making him an unrestricted free agent (UFA) in 2026 if he reaches that point.

Latest Updates & Future Outlook

Trade Movements

Marchment’s career has been dynamic:

  • June 2025: Traded from the Dallas Stars to the Seattle Kraken in exchange for draft picks, adding veteran presence and size to the Kraken roster. 

  • December 2025: Reported move from the Kraken to the Columbus Blue Jackets, reflecting roster adjustments and team strategies late in the season.
